Exodus 35:1Moses assembled all the congregation of the children of Israel, and said to them, "These are the words which Yahweh has commanded, that you should do them.And Moses assembleth all the company of the sons of Israel, and saith unto them, `These [are] the things which Jehovah hath commanded to do them:And Moses gathered all the congregation of the children of Israel together, and said unto them, These are the words which the LORD hath commanded, that ye should do them.
Exodus 35:2'Six days shall work be done, but on the seventh day there shall be a holy day for you, a Sabbath of solemn rest to Yahweh: whoever does any work in it shall be put to death.Six days is work done, and on the seventh day there is to you a holy [day], a sabbath of rest to Jehovah; any who doeth work in it is put to death;Six days shall work be done, but on the seventh day there shall be to you an holy day, a sabbath of rest to the LORD: whosoever doeth work therein shall be put to death.
Exodus 35:3You shall kindle no fire throughout your habitations on the Sabbath day.'"ye do not burn a fire in any of your dwellings on the sabbath-day.`Ye shall kindle no fire throughout your habitations upon the sabbath day.
Exodus 35:4Moses spoke to all the congregation of the children of Israel, saying, "This is the thing which Yahweh commanded, saying,And Moses speaketh unto all the company of the sons of Israel, saying, `This [is] the thing which Jehovah hath commanded, saying,And Moses spake unto all the congregation of the children of Israel, saying, This is the thing which the LORD commanded, saying,
Exodus 35:5'Take from among you an offering to Yahweh. Whoever is of a willing heart, let him bring it, Yahweh's offering: gold, silver, brass,Take ye from among you a heave-offering to Jehovah; every one whose heart [is] willing doth bring it, the heave-offering of Jehovah, gold, and silver, and brass,Take ye from among you an offering unto the LORD: whosoever is of a willing heart, let him bring it, an offering of the LORD; gold, and silver, and brass,
Exodus 35:6blue, purple, scarlet, fine linen, goats' hair,and blue, and purple, and scarlet, and linen, and goats` [hair],And blue, and purple, and scarlet, and fine linen, and goats' hair,
Exodus 35:7rams' skins dyed red, sea cow hides, acacia wood,and rams` skins made red, and badgers` skins, and shittim wood,And rams' skins dyed red, and badgers' skins, and shittim wood,
Exodus 35:8oil for the light, spices for the anointing oil and for the sweet incense,and oil for the light, and spices for the anointing oil, and for the spice perfume,And oil for the light, and spices for anointing oil, and for the sweet incense,
Exodus 35:9onyx stones, and stones to be set for the ephod and for the breastplate.and shoham stones, and stones for settings, for an ephod, and for a breastplate.And onyx stones, and stones to be set for the ephod, and for the breastplate.
Exodus 35:10"Let every wise-hearted man among you come, and make all that Yahweh has commanded:`And all the wise-hearted among you come in, and make all that Jehovah hath commanded:And every wise hearted among you shall come, and make all that the LORD hath commanded;
Exodus 35:11the tent, its outer covering, its roof, its clasps, its boards, its bars, its pillars, and its sockets;`The tabernacle, its tent, and its covering, its hooks, and its boards, its bars, its pillars, and its sockets,The tabernacle, his tent, and his covering, his taches, and his boards, his bars, his pillars, and his sockets,
Exodus 35:12the ark, and its poles, the mercy seat, the veil of the screen;`The ark and its staves, the mercy-seat, and the vail of the covering,The ark, and the staves thereof, with the mercy seat, and the vail of the covering,
Exodus 35:13the table with its poles and all its vessels, and the show bread;`The table and its staves, and all its vessels, and the bread of the presence,The table, and his staves, and all his vessels, and the shewbread,
Exodus 35:14the lampstand also for the light, with its vessels, its lamps, and the oil for the light;`And the candlestick for the light, and its vessels, and its lamps, and the oil for the light,The candlestick also for the light, and his furniture, and his lamps, with the oil for the light,
Exodus 35:15and the altar of incense with its poles, the anointing oil, the sweet incense, the screen for the door, at the door of the tent;`And the altar of perfume, and its staves, and the anointing oil, and the spice perfume, and the covering of the opening at the opening of the tabernacle,And the incense altar, and his staves, and the anointing oil, and the sweet incense, and the hanging for the door at the entering in of the tabernacle,
Exodus 35:16the altar of burnt offering, with its grating of brass, it poles, and all its vessels, the basin and its base;`The altar of burnt-offering and the brazen grate which it hath, its staves, and all its vessels, the laver and its base,The altar of burnt offering, with his brasen grate, his staves, and all his vessels, the laver and his foot,
Exodus 35:17the hangings of the court, its pillars, their sockets, and the screen for the gate of the court;`The hangings of the court, its pillars, and their sockets, and the covering of the gate of the court,The hangings of the court, his pillars, and their sockets, and the hanging for the door of the court,
Exodus 35:18the pins of the tent, the pins of the court, and their cords;`The pins of the tabernacle, and the pins of the court, and their cords,The pins of the tabernacle, and the pins of the court, and their cords,
Exodus 35:19the finely worked garments, for ministering in the holy place, the holy garments for Aaron the priest, and the garments of his sons, to minister in the priest's office.'"`The coloured garments, to do service in the sanctuary, the holy garments for Aaron the priest, and the garments of his sons to act as priest in.`The cloths of service, to do service in the holy place, the holy garments for Aaron the priest, and the garments of his sons, to minister in the priest's office.
Exodus 35:20All the congregation of the children of Israel departed from the presence of Moses.And all the company of the sons of Israel go out from the presence of Moses,And all the congregation of the children of Israel departed from the presence of Moses.
Exodus 35:21They came, everyone whose heart stirred him up, and everyone whom his spirit made willing, and brought Yahweh's offering, for the work of the tent of meeting, and for all of its service, and for the holy garments.and they come in every man whom his heart hath lifted up, and every one whom his spirit hath made willing they have brought in the heave-offering of Jehovah for the work of the tent of meeting, and for all its service, and for the holy garments.And they came, every one whose heart stirred him up, and every one whom his spirit made willing, and they brought the LORD's offering to the work of the tabernacle of the congregation, and for all his service, and for the holy garments.
Exodus 35:22They came, both men and women, as many as were willing-hearted, and brought brooches, ear-rings, signet-rings, and armlets, all jewels of gold; even every man who offered an offering of gold to Yahweh.And they come in the men with the women every willing-hearted one they have brought in nose-ring, and ear-ring, and seal-ring, and necklace, all golden goods, even every one who hath waved a wave-offering of gold to Jehovah.And they came, both men and women, as many as were willing hearted, and brought bracelets, and earrings, and rings, and tablets, all jewels of gold: and every man that offered offered an offering of gold unto the LORD.
Exodus 35:23Everyone, with whom was found blue, purple, scarlet, fine linen, goats' hair, rams' skins dyed red, and sea cow hides, brought them.And every man with whom hath been found blue, and purple, and scarlet, and linen, and goats` [hair], and rams` skins made red, and badgers` skins, have brought [them] in;And every man, with whom was found blue, and purple, and scarlet, and fine linen, and goats' hair, and red skins of rams, and badgers' skins, brought them.
Exodus 35:24Everyone who did offer an offering of silver and brass brought Yahweh's offering; and everyone, with whom was found acacia wood for any work of the service, brought it.every one lifting up a heave-offering of silver and brass have brought in the heave-offering of Jehovah; and every one with whom hath been found shittim wood for any work of the service brought [it] in.Every one that did offer an offering of silver and brass brought the LORD's offering: and every man, with whom was found shittim wood for any work of the service, brought it.
Exodus 35:25All the women who were wise-hearted spun with their hands, and brought that which they had spun, the blue, the purple, the scarlet, and the fine linen.And every wise-hearted woman hath spun with her hands, and they bring in yarn, the blue, and the purple, the scarlet, and the linen;And all the women that were wise hearted did spin with their hands, and brought that which they had spun, both of blue, and of purple, and of scarlet, and of fine linen.
Exodus 35:26All the women whose heart stirred them up in wisdom spun the goats' hair.and all the women whose heart hath lifted them up in wisdom, have spun the goats` [hair].And all the women whose heart stirred them up in wisdom spun goats' hair.
Exodus 35:27The rulers brought the onyx stones, and the stones to be set, for the ephod and for the breastplate;And the princes have brought in the shoham stones, and the stones for settings, for the ephod, and for the breastplate,And the rulers brought onyx stones, and stones to be set, for the ephod, and for the breastplate;
Exodus 35:28and the spice, and the oil for the light, for the anointing oil, and for the sweet incense.and the spices, and the oil for the light, and for the anointing oil, and for the spice perfume;And spice, and oil for the light, and for the anointing oil, and for the sweet incense.
Exodus 35:29The children of Israel brought a freewill offering to Yahweh; every man and woman, whose heart made them willing to bring for all the work, which Yahweh had commanded to be made by Moses.every man and woman (whom their heart hath made willing to bring in for all the work which Jehovah commanded to be done by the hand of Moses) [of] the sons of Israel brought in a willing-offering to Jehovah.The children of Israel brought a willing offering unto the LORD, every man and woman, whose heart made them willing to bring for all manner of work, which the LORD had commanded to be made by the hand of Moses.
Exodus 35:30Moses said to the children of Israel, "Behold, Yahweh has called by name Bezalel the son of Uri, the son of Hur, of the tribe of Judah.And Moses saith unto the sons of Israel, `See, Jehovah hath called by name Bezaleel, son of Uri, son of Hur, of the tribe of Judah,And Moses said unto the children of Israel, See, the LORD hath called by name Bezaleel the son of Uri, the son of Hur, of the tribe of Judah;
Exodus 35:31He has filled him with the Spirit of God, in wisdom, in understanding, in knowledge, and in all manner of workmanship;and He doth fill him [with] the Spirit of God, in wisdom, in understanding, and in knowledge, and in all work,And he hath filled him with the spirit of God, in wisdom, in understanding, and in knowledge, and in all manner of workmanship;
Exodus 35:32and to make skillful works, to work in gold, in silver, in brass,even to devise devices to work in gold, and in silver, and in brass,And to devise curious works, to work in gold, and in silver, and in brass,
Exodus 35:33in cutting of stones for setting, and in carving of wood, to work in all kinds of skillful workmanship.and in graving of stones for settings, and in graving of wood to work in any work of design.And in the cutting of stones, to set them, and in carving of wood, to make any manner of cunning work.
Exodus 35:34He has put in his heart that he may teach, both he, and Oholiab, the son of Ahisamach, of the tribe of Dan.`And to direct He hath put in his heart, he and Aholiab, son of Ahisamach, of the tribe of Dan;And he hath put in his heart that he may teach, both he, and Aholiab, the son of Ahisamach, of the tribe of Dan.
Exodus 35:35He has filled them with wisdom of heart, to work all manner of workmanship, of the engraver, of the skillful workman, and of the embroiderer, in blue, in purple, in scarlet, and in fine linen, and of the weaver, even of those who do any workmanship, and of those who make skillful works.He hath filled them with wisdom of heart to do every work, of engraver, and designer, and embroiderer (in blue, and in purple, in scarlet, and in linen), and weaver, who do any work, and of designers of designs.Them hath he filled with wisdom of heart, to work all manner of work, of the engraver, and of the cunning workman, and of the embroiderer, in blue, and in purple, in scarlet, and in fine linen, and of the weaver, even of them that do any work, and of those that devise cunning work.
